The U.S. stock market continued to rise. The Dow Jones Industrial Average closed at 42,512.00, up 431.63 points, and the Nasdaq ended trading at 18,291.62, up 108.70 points.

After the Federal Reserve Board's (FRB) quick expectations of a rate cut receded, the market fell after the opening. However, on any pullbacks, the market was bought on expectations that China's government's fiscal strengthening measures aimed at bottoming out the economy would support global economic recovery and corporate sales. The market turned higher. It was revealed that all participants at the Federal Reserve Board's September Federal Open Market Committee (FOMC) agreed to continue the rate cut, and as a result, the market expanded its gains towards the end of the session. The Dow hit a record high and closed at the highest level. In terms of sectors, property service and development, technology hardware and equipment rose, while utilities declined.

Home Depot (HD), Loews (LOW) operating in the home improvement sector, and Norwegian Cruise Line (NCLH) in the cruise ship industry all rose due to investment upgrades by analysts. Pfizer (PFE) the pharmaceutical company, saw an increase as CEO Albert Bourla reportedly plans to meet with major executives at Starboard Value, activist investors pushing for the improvement of the company's business. Google, operated by Alphabet (GOOG), fell as the Department of Justice received a court ruling that Google's internet search is considered a monopoly and may potentially require the company to split its business, including the Chrome browser and Android operating system.

Boeing (BA), the aircraft manufacturer, faced the possibility of prolonged strikes due to negotiations breaking down with its largest labor union. Furthermore, S&P Global Ratings warned of a potential downgrade in Boeing's credit rating to speculative grade levels, leading to a decline. Disney (DIS) in the entertainment sector announced theme park closures in preparation for Hurricane Milton, raising concerns about decreased earnings.

The VIX Index, reflecting investors' fear, dropped to 20.71.
